Discover the fascinating world of eye tracking with Eye Tracking by Kenneth Holmqvist, published by Oxford University Press in 2015. This comprehensive handbook, spanning 560 pages, serves as an essential resource for anyone interested in understanding eye movements and their significance in processing the overwhelming amount of information we encounter daily.
In this insightful guide, Holmqvist expertly outlines the methodologies of eye tracking, providing readers with valuable knowledge on how to evaluate and acquire an eye-tracker, plan and design effective studies, and accurately record and analyze eye movement data.
